Zoey Rana grew up in Southeast England in the community of Crawley. As a Muslim, she was raised with strict parents, especially a strict father. Her parents had her life all mapped out but from an early age, Zoey wasn’t interested in the life they had planned. It took moving to another country to free herself of the religious oppression she felt in Crawley. Zoey also has been diagnosed with borderline personality disorder which she openly discusses as she tells her story. She feels she has benefitted greatly from the podcast, From Borderline to Beautiful: Hope and Help for BPD with Rose Skeeters.
